Original Description
Henri Charles Manguin's Esquisse Pour Le Paysage De Rêve À Colombier captures the radiant essence of Fauvism through its bold, emotive use of color and dynamic brushwork. Painted during the early 20th century, this study (or esquisse) reflects Manguin's love for Mediterranean light and lush landscapes, translating fleeting impressions into vibrant harmonies of blue, green, and warm ochres. As a close associate of Matisse and Derain, Manguin played a pivotal role in the Fauvist movement, which liberated color from naturalistic representation—prioritizing emotional expression over form. This piece exemplifies his mastery of balancing intensity with serenity, making it a significant, though often underrepresented, touchstone in modernist landscape painting. Today, it bridges decorative charm and avant-garde audacity, appealing to collectors of both Post-Impressionist and early modernist works.
